Continual non-cancer pain (CNCP), which persists beyond the assumed normal tissue therapeutic time of 3 months, is claimed by more than thirty% of Americans (four).
Within a current study, we noted the identification as well as characterization of a completely new atypical opioid receptor with exceptional unfavorable regulatory Qualities in direction of opioid peptides.1 Our benefits confirmed that ACKR3/CXCR7, hitherto often called an atypical scavenger receptor for chemokines CXCL12 and CXCL11, can also be a broad-spectrum scavenger for opioid peptides on the enkephalin, dynorphin, and nociceptin people, regulating their availability for classical opioid receptors.
Scientists have just lately discovered and succeeded in synthesizing conolidine, a organic compound that displays assure like a potent analgesic agent with a more favorable safety profile. Even though the exact mechanism of action continues to be elusive, it is at this time postulated that conolidine might have many biologic targets. Presently, conolidine is proven to inhibit Cav2.2 calcium channels and maximize The supply of endogenous opioid peptides by binding to your recently identified opioid scavenger ACKR3. Even though the identification of conolidine as a possible novel analgesic agent supplies an extra avenue to address the opioid disaster and deal with CNCP, even more scientific tests are needed to comprehend its system of motion and utility and efficacy in handling CNCP.

Investigation on conolidine is limited, though the several reports now available clearly show that the drug holds guarantee as being a probable opiate-like therapeutic for chronic pain. Conolidine was initially synthesized in 2011 as A part of a review by Tarselli et al. (sixty) The initial de novo pathway to artificial output observed that their synthesized form served as powerful analgesics versus Persistent, persistent pain in an in-vivo model (60). A biphasic pain product was utilized, by which formalin Remedy is injected into a rodent’s paw. This leads to a Principal pain response quickly following injection along with a secondary pain reaction twenty - 40 minutes right after injection (62).
